> I found why the vmVersionInfo.h isn't there...
>
> build.sh contains:
>
> #!bash
>
> if [ ! -e vmVersionInfo.h ]; then
>       ../codegen-scripts/extract-commit-info.sh
> fi
> cmake -G "MSYS Makefiles" .
> make
>
>
> and ../codegen-scripts/extract-commit-info.sh is nowhere to be found from the git clone...
>
> It lives in scripts/

> I've been moving forward with building the VM for Windows from the GitHub sources with MinGW.
>
> Now, to get the thing to compile, I had to replace the oft_t things by _oft_t, same for the 64 flavor.
>
> So, modifiying two header files, one being mingw.h where I put #define oft_t _oft_t at the end.
>
> This did the trick and I now have all plugins/dlls building fine:
>
> FT2Plugin.dll
> libcairo-2.dll
> libeay32.dll
> libfreetype-6.dll
> libfreetype.dll.a
> libFT2Plugin.dll.a
> libpixman-1-0.dll
> libpng-3.dll
> libSqueakFFIPrims.dll.a
> libSqueakSSL.dll.a
> SqueakFFIPrims.dll
> SqueakSSL.dll
> ssleay32.dll
> zlib1.dll
>
> are in results/
>
> Also, to get there, one has to create a vmVersionInfo.h file in platforms\Cross\vm with something in the REVISION_STRING
>
> #define REVISION_STRING "Pharo VM - Philippe Back from GitHub Sources 20131119"
>
> I wonder why this isn't something automagically generated in the process as it seems that the CI build has something.
